Ramp Replacement in Wilmington, NC
Ramp replacement services involve removing and updating existing ramps to improve safety, accessibility, and appearance. These projects typically include replacing worn or damaged materials, upgrading to more durable options, or modifying the ramp’s design to better suit the property’s needs. Homeowners often seek this service when existing ramps are no longer functional, have become unsafe, or do not meet current accessibility standards. Understanding the scope of work, the types of materials available, and the specific requirements of the property can help in planning a successful replacement project.
Property owners considering ramp replacement should assess the current condition of the existing structure and determine whether repairs are sufficient or if a full replacement is necessary. It’s also important to consider the intended use, local building codes, and any aesthetic preferences. Clear communication about the scope of the project, the materials used, and the expected outcomes can ensure the replacement process aligns with the property’s needs and accessibility goals.

Ramp Replacement Questions
What are signs that a ramp needs replacement? Visible damage, such as cracks, warping, or rust, indicates that a ramp may require replacement to ensure safety and functionality.
What types of ramps can be replaced? Various ramps, including wheelchair, loading, and accessibility ramps, can be replaced to suit different property needs.
Why choose ramp replacement services? Replacing a ramp improves safety, accessibility, and durability, especially when existing structures become worn or unsafe.
What should property owners consider before replacing a ramp? Factors include the ramp’s condition, the property's accessibility requirements, and compliance with local building standards.
